  • the present invention relates generally to franking machines. Its purpose is a label selector for the selective supply of short or long labels of a franking machine, depending on whether one wishes to print a postage stamp alone or a postage stamp accompanied by a additional fixed information such as an advertising flame for example.
  • the existing franking machines comprise, in a known manner, in a rotary drum printing head, first means assigned to printing a franking stamp and second retractable means assigned to printing fixed information. , such as an advertising flame, for example.
  • This same head is also equipped with a control lever linked to these second printing means, for their retraction or not.
  • the control lever is mounted at the end of the head for its accessibility; it can be actuated manually in a first position, for which the second means are retracted and the head will then only ensure the printing of the postage stamp alone, and in a second position for which the second printing means are not retracted and the print head will print the postage stamp and the advertising flame one after the other.
  • This single or double printing is carried out either directly on envelopes or on short or long labels depending on the impression they should receive.
  • the labels after printing will be stuck on folds or packages.
  • the print head and an associated counter-roller are mounted to receive between them the envelopes driven by a transport mechanism as well as the labels to be printed.
  • These labels are issued by an automatic label dispenser fitted to franking machines.
  • the labels are advantageously taken on demand from a continuous postage tape cut to the length of the desired labels.
  • the postage tape is intermittently driven, response to an external command, to release in response to another external command for selecting a short or long label a first or a second length of ribbon which is cut by a knife.
  • a crank rod of the label strip length advance mechanism has a button for selecting the label length for the operator and takes one of two possible positions to which correspond the two lengths of labels.
  • a plate, belonging to this crank rod and having a lug ensures in correspondence the opening of a microswitch during the selection of long labels and its closure during the selection of short labels.
  • This microswitch is inserted in the supply circuit of the electromagnet for controlling the retractable printing means, for placing them in the retracted or raised position depending on whether the armature of the electromagnet is energized or at rest.
  • the aim of the present invention is to provide a safe and reliable selection control between short labels and long labels which a label dispenser delivers to a franking machine, to exclude double printing while the franking machine is supplied. in short labels, for which part of the double printing would pass on the backing roller.
  • the present invention therefore relates to a label selector for a distributor of short and long labels ensuring, in response to a manual command, the selective feeding of a franking machine coupled to the dispenser and comprising a printing drum equipped with first fixed means for printing a franking stamp and second retractable means for printing of additional information known as an advertising flame and control means mechanically coupled to said second printing means for their selective actuation in a first retracted position of non-printing of advertising flame and in a second raised position of advertising flame printing, said selector being coupled to said control means of the second printing means and characterized in that it comprises said control means constituted by a manual lever with two positions for the two positions of the second printing means, mounted at the end of the drum , said advertising lever and also constituting said manual selector control , and a position detector of said lever, said position detector comprising a transmitter and a receiver mounted relative to said advertising lever to be coupled to each other in a single chosen one of the two positions of the lever and being connected to said label dispenser, to directly deliver a signal for
  • said transmitter and receiver are both mounted at a distance from the lever and form the same opto-electronic head, and said lever carries a mirror ensuring their coupling for that of the positions of the lever for which said second means assigned at the printing of the advertising flame are retracted, for the non-printing of the advertising flame.
  • the franking machine being as such of known type, it has simply been shown schematically by illustrating in the figure a printing drum 1, integral with a shaft 2 for its drive in rotation, according to arrow 3.
  • This drum belongs to the printing head of the machine. It carries a first engraved printing plate, called a franking plate; this first curved plate 4 is fixed on the periphery of the drum.
  • Means for printing the postage amount and generally the date for example of the type with internal printing wheels of the drum and adjustable in position or of the type with ink jet printing device controlled in synchronism with the drum, not shown, associated with it, for printing through suitable windows that it has corresponding indications of postage.
  • the printing drum 1 also carries a second engraved printing plate 5 retractably mounted on its periphery.
  • This second printing plate 5, called the advertising flame plate is intended for the possible printing of fixed additional information, such as an advertising flame for example.
  • This advertising flame plate is linked by a set of articulated rods symbolized by the connection in dashed lines 6 to a control lever 7.
  • the control lever 7, called the advertising lever is mounted at the end of the printing drum 1 and is actuable by an operator in a first position, given in dotted lines, for which the advertising flame plate 5 is put in the retracted position also illustrated in correspondence in dotted lines, and in a second position, given in solid lines, for which the plate advertising flame 5 is placed in the non-retracted or printing position given in correspondence in solid lines.
  • a flat 8 on the printing drum makes it possible to define a rest position of the drum and the location of this rest position. It is in this drum rest position that the advertising lever 7 is placed in one of its first and second positions for controlling the positioning of the advertising flame plate.
  • guide means of the end ball type, resiliently biased are provided on the rear face of the lever 7 and two cylinder imprints connected by a groove in an arc of a circle are provided in the end face of the drum so that the first and second positions of the lever are stable positions.
  • This counter-roller 10 like the drum 1, is supported by the chassis not shown in the machine.
  • the counter-roller 10 is in practice elastically urged to cooperate effectively with the drum during printing; when the print head is at rest, the flat part 8 of the drum faces the counter-roller, leaving a relatively wide gap between them.
  • a table 14 called the envelope printing table, defines the path for guiding and driving envelopes between the printing drum 1 and the printing counter-roller 10.
  • the envelopes are driven along arrow 15 between the drum and the counter-roller; once the printing is done, they are evacuated according to arrow 16.
  • an inlet chute 20 defines the path for guiding and driving labels between the printing drum and the counter-roller and a chute 21 defines the output of the printed labels.
  • a part 22 with window guides the labels only by their edges, on the upper part of the counter-roller facing the printing drum.
  • the labels are driven along arrow 23 in the chute 20; a roller 24 shown arranged under pressure with the counter-roller ensures their drive on the counter-roller, once printed they are discharged according to arrow 25.
  • the inlet chute 20 is constituted by the outlet of an automatic label dispenser 30, of known general type, which in practice equips the franking machine.
  • This dispenser 30, ensures, from a continuous franking tape 31, mounted in a roll, the supply of the franking machine with short and long labels, on demand.
  • it comprises a first external control input 32, for controlling the distribution of labels, and a second control input 33 for controlling the selection between short or long label.
  • a mechanism 34 ensures the driving of the ribbon over a first or second given length for the removal from the ribbon of the suitable label.
  • the franking machine is furthermore equipped with a label selector 40 which directly controls the input 33 to which its output is connected.
  • the selector 40 constitutes a detector of a single chosen position of the advertising lever 7, for the rest position of the drum 1. It comprises a transmitter E and a receiver R mounted relative to the lever 7 so as not to be coupled to it. to each other only when the lever is in the chosen position of the lever.
  • this transmitter and this receiver are mounted remotely from the lever in the same opto-electronic detection head 41, E / R transmitter-receiver, incorporating or connected to amplification and processing circuits of the electrical output signal. of the receiver.
  • the lever carries, meanwhile a reflecting mirror 42 receiving the light from the transmitter and returning it to the receiver when the lever 7 is in said first position, for which the advertising flame printing plate 5 is in the retracted position or not printing.
  • the detection head 41 is mounted under the envelope printing table 14, in which is formed a window 43 transparent to light rays, on the path of the radiation light emitted by the head and reflected back by the mirror. This trajectory is illustrated at 44; it is in the figure substantially perpendicular to the mirror for this first position of the lever.
  • a support 45 fixed on the head 41 maintains the head 41 on the chassis of the machine.
  • the head delivers on the input 33 of the distributor a short label selection signal .
  • the signal delivered by the head translates the absence of coupling between the transmitter and the receiver, this signal on the input 33 constitutes the long label selection signal.
  • the signal on the short or long label selection input 33 will only be taken into account when the printing drum 1 is in the rest position and a distribution command d the label will be applied to the input 32.
  • a circuit 35 controlled by the label distribution signal present on the input 32 ensures sampling or detection of the signal level applied by the head 41 to the input 33, to control said means 34 for driving the ribbon accordingly.
  • the label selector is mounted to ensure the remote detection of the position of non-printing flame advertising of the lever 7 for which the distributor issues a short label. Detecting this precise position rather than the other is particularly advantageous. Indeed, in the event of a possible failure of the head, its output signal applied to input 33 will translate a long label selection command, this even if the lever is in the first position for which the flame plate advertising is retracted. The opposite choice, consisting in detecting the other position of the lever, would lead, on the other hand, in the event of a possible failure of the head, to the selection of a short label and then to a transfer Advertising flame on the backing roll may occur if the sensor head fails.

Claims (4)

  1. Etikettenwähler für einen Spender von kurzen und langen Aufklebern, der aufgrund einer manuellen Bedienung die selektive Versorgung einer mit dem Spender gekoppelten Frankiermaschine bewirkt und eine Druckwalze (1), die erste feststehende Mittel (4) zum Drucken einer Frankiermarke und zweite zurückziehbare Mittel (5) zum Drucken einer zusätzlichen Information, Werbeslogan genannt, sowie Steuermittel (7) aufweist, die mit den zweiten Druckmitteln zu deren selektiver Einstellung in einer ersten zurückgezogenen Position des Nichtdruckens des Werbeslogans und in einer zweiten ausgerückten Position des Druckens des Werbeslogans mechanisch gekoppelt ist, wobei der Etiketten-Wähler mit den Steuermitteln (7) der zweiten Druckmittel gekoppelt ist, dadurch gekennzeichnet, daß der Etikettenwähler die Steuermittel (7) , bestehend aus einem Handhebel mit zwei Stellungen für die beiden Positionen der zweiten Druckmittel, der am Ende der Walze angebracht ist, Werbehebel genannt wird und zugleich die genannte manuelle Bedienung des Wählers bildet, sowie einen Stellungsdetektor (41) für den Hebel aufweist, wobei der Stellungsdetektor einen Sender und einen Empfänger aufweist, die relativ zum Werbehebel angebracht sind, um in nur einer einzigen gewählten der beiden Stellungen des Hebels miteinander gekoppelt zu sein, und wobei der Detektor mit dem Etikettenspender (30) verbunden ist, um ihm direkt ein Wählsignal für die Etikettenlänge zu liefern.
  2. Etikettenwähler nach Anspruch 1, dadurch gekennzeichnet, daß der Sender und der Empfänger (41) für diejenige der beiden Stellungen des Werbehebels (7) miteinander gekoppelt sind, die der ersten zurückgezogenen Position der zweiten Druckmittel (5) entspricht.
  3. Etikettenwähler nach Anspruch 2, dadurch gekennzeichnet, daß der Sender und der Empfänger (41) opto-elektronischer Natur sind und beide im Abstand vom Werbehebel (7) in einem gemeinsamen Sender-Empfänger-Kopf angebracht sind, und daß der Hebel (7) mit einem Mittel (42) versehen ist, das deren Kopplung für diese gewählte Stellung des Hebels bewirkt.
  4. Etikettenwähler nach einem der Ansprüche 1 bis 3, dadurch gekennzeichnet, daß er eine Schaltung (35) zur Erfassung des Pegels des Wählsignals aufweist, das durch ein Steuersignal des Etikettenspenders ausgelöst wird.
